Title : An improved Chaos based Image Encryption Scheme Using 128-Bit Key

Author : Deshdeepak Shrivastava-a, Dr Renu Begoria-b and Dr Aditya Vidyarthi-c

Abstract :

With the rapid advancement of digital technologies, multimedia content such as images has become increasingly accessible and widely distributed. However, this growth has also raised significant concerns regarding the security and privacy of data during transmission and storage. In today's multimedia-driven world, images play a pivotal role in sectors like business, marketing, and digital promotions. Consequently, protecting image data from unauthorized access is of paramount importance. Image encryption serves as a crucial tool in the domain of information hiding. This article presents an enhanced chaos-based image encryption method that utilizes a 128-bit symmetric key for robust security. The effectiveness of the proposed encryption approach is evaluated using JDK1.7 and benchmarked against existing techniques. Experimental results demonstrate that the proposed scheme achieves higher entropy in the encrypted images, indicating improved security performance over traditional methods.
